Responsibilities

  • Lead, manage, mentor, and develop a high-performing team of four analysts/specialists, including coaching, performance reviews, and fostering professional growth
  • Act as a "working manager" by personally executing complex data modeling, compensation analysis, and HRIS configuration/administration
  • Provide technical guidance, upskill the team, and cultivate a collaborative environment embodying "Think Team" and "Share the Knowledge" values
  • Design, implement, and administer global compensation programs (base pay, incentive plans, sales compensation) ensuring internal equity and external competitiveness across regions
  • Partner with executive leadership and Finance on strategic workforce planning, including long-range headcount forecasting, organizational design, and capacity planning
  • Direct team efforts and personally conduct complex workforce analytics to provide actionable insights on trends (e.g., attrition, talent gaps) and inform strategic talent decisions like compensation packages and talent calibration
  • Serve as a strategic partner to the COO, bridging financial strategy, business operations, and talent management
  • Drive alignment across senior leadership to ensure the right talent in the right place at the right time, optimizing scalable and compliant People processes through HR technology management

About ServiceRocket

ServiceRocket offers solutions and services for Atlassian products like Jira and Confluence, including consulting, training, managed services, licensing, and apps. The company helps businesses of all sizes optimize their use of Atlassian software to improve project management and collaboration. Unlike its competitors, ServiceRocket provides a comprehensive suite of services tailored to enhance the value of Atlassian investments. The goal is to maximize productivity and efficiency for organizations using these tools.
